WebProblems with mental abilities. As with other types of dementia, dementia with Lewy bodies typically causes problems with: thinking speed. understanding. judgement. visual perception. language. memory (but significant memory loss may not occur until later on) These problems may be constant but typically tend to come and go. btc haitian flag

WebApr 26, 2024 · Visual hallucinations, stiff movements, tremors, apathy and cognitive changes are symptoms of this underdiagnosed condition. The multisystem disease affects more than 1 million people and their families in the U.S. alone. WebJul 4, 2024 · Lewy body dementia is a condition that affects cognitive abilities.
